package java.lang.invoke; |
|
import sun.invoke.util.Wrapper; |
|
import static java.lang.invoke.MethodHandleNatives.mapLookupExceptionToError; |
|
import static java.util.Objects.requireNonNull; |
|
/** |
|
* Bootstrap methods for dynamically-computed constants. |
|
* |
|
* <p>The bootstrap methods in this class will throw a |
|
* {@code NullPointerException} for any reference argument that is {@code null}, |
|
* unless the argument is specified to be unused or specified to accept a |
|
* {@code null} value. |
|
* |
|
* @since 11 |
|
*/ |
|
public final class ConstantBootstraps { |
|
// implements the upcall from the JVM, MethodHandleNatives.linkDynamicConstant: |
|
/*non-public*/ |
|
static Object makeConstant(MethodHandle bootstrapMethod, |
|
// Callee information: |
|
String name, Class<?> type, |
|
// Extra arguments for BSM, if any: |
|
Object info, |
|
// Caller information: |
|
Class<?> callerClass) { |
|
// Restrict bootstrap methods to those whose first parameter is Lookup |
|
// The motivation here is, in the future, to possibly support BSMs |
|
// that do not accept the meta-data of lookup/name/type, thereby |
|
// allowing the co-opting of existing methods to be used as BSMs as |
|
// long as the static arguments can be passed as method arguments |
|
MethodType mt = bootstrapMethod.type(); |
|
if (mt.parameterCount() < 2 || |
|
!MethodHandles.Lookup.class.isAssignableFrom(mt.parameterType(0))) { |
|
throw new BootstrapMethodError( |
|
"Invalid bootstrap method declared for resolving a dynamic constant: " + bootstrapMethod); |
|
} |
|
// BSMI.invoke handles all type checking and exception translation. |
|
// If type is not a reference type, the JVM is expecting a boxed |
|
// version, and will manage unboxing on the other side. |
|
return BootstrapMethodInvoker.invoke( |
|
type, bootstrapMethod, name, type, info, callerClass); |
|
} |
|
/** |
|
* Returns a {@code null} object reference for the reference type specified |
|
* by {@code type}. |
|
* |
|
* @param lookup unused |
|
* @param name unused |
|
* @param type a reference type |
|
* @return a {@code null} value |
|
* @throws IllegalArgumentException if {@code type} is not a reference type |
|
*/ |
|
public static Object nullConstant(MethodHandles.Lookup lookup, String name, Class<?> type) { |
|
if (requireNonNull(type).isPrimitive()) { |
|
throw new IllegalArgumentException(String.format("not reference: %s", type)); |
|
} |
|
return null; |
|
} |
|
/** |
|
* Returns a {@link Class} mirror for the primitive type whose type |
|
* descriptor is specified by {@code name}. |
|
* |
|
* @param lookup unused |
|
* @param name the descriptor (JVMS 4.3) of the desired primitive type |
|
* @param type the required result type (must be {@code Class.class}) |
|
* @return the {@link Class} mirror |
|
* @throws IllegalArgumentException if the name is not a descriptor for a |
|
* primitive type or the type is not {@code Class.class} |
|
*/ |
|
public static Class<?> primitiveClass(MethodHandles.Lookup lookup, String name, Class<?> type) { |
|
requireNonNull(name); |
|
requireNonNull(type); |
|
if (type != Class.class) { |
|
throw new IllegalArgumentException(); |
|
} |
|
if (name.length() == 0 || name.length() > 1) { |
|
throw new IllegalArgumentException(String.format("not primitive: %s", name)); |
|
} |
|
return Wrapper.forPrimitiveType(name.charAt(0)).primitiveType(); |
|
} |
|
/** |
|
* Returns an {@code enum} constant of the type specified by {@code type} |
|
* with the name specified by {@code name}. |
|
* |
|
* @param lookup the lookup context describing the class performing the |
|
* operation (normally stacked by the JVM) |
|
* @param name the name of the constant to return, which must exactly match |
|
* an enum constant in the specified type. |
|
* @param type the {@code Class} object describing the enum type for which |
|
* a constant is to be returned |
|
* @param <E> The enum type for which a constant value is to be returned |
|
* @return the enum constant of the specified enum type with the |
|
* specified name |
|
* @throws IllegalAccessError if the declaring class or the field is not |
|
* accessible to the class performing the operation |
|
* @throws IllegalArgumentException if the specified enum type has |
|
* no constant with the specified name, or the specified |
|
* class object does not represent an enum type |
|
* @see Enum#valueOf(Class, String) |
|
*/ |
|
public static <E extends Enum<E>> E enumConstant(MethodHandles.Lookup lookup, String name, Class<E> type) { |
|
requireNonNull(lookup); |
|
requireNonNull(name); |
|
requireNonNull(type); |
|
validateClassAccess(lookup, type); |
|
return Enum.valueOf(type, name); |
|
} |
|
/** |
|
* Returns the value of a static final field. |
|
* |
|
* @param lookup the lookup context describing the class performing the |
|
* operation (normally stacked by the JVM) |
|
* @param name the name of the field |
|
* @param type the type of the field |
|
* @param declaringClass the class in which the field is declared |
|
* @return the value of the field |
|
* @throws IllegalAccessError if the declaring class or the field is not |
|
* accessible to the class performing the operation |
|
* @throws NoSuchFieldError if the specified field does not exist |
|
* @throws IncompatibleClassChangeError if the specified field is not |
|
* {@code final} |
|
*/ |
|
public static Object getStaticFinal(MethodHandles.Lookup lookup, String name, Class<?> type, |
|
Class<?> declaringClass) { |
|
requireNonNull(lookup); |
|
requireNonNull(name); |
|
requireNonNull(type); |
|
requireNonNull(declaringClass); |
|
MethodHandle mh; |
|
try { |
|
mh = lookup.findStaticGetter(declaringClass, name, type); |
|
MemberName member = mh.internalMemberName(); |
|
if (!member.isFinal()) { |
|
throw new IncompatibleClassChangeError("not a final field: " + name); |
|
} |
|
} |
|
catch (ReflectiveOperationException ex) { |
|
throw mapLookupExceptionToError(ex); |
|
} |
|
// Since mh is a handle to a static field only instances of |
|
// VirtualMachineError are anticipated to be thrown, such as a |
|
// StackOverflowError or an InternalError from the j.l.invoke code |
|
try { |
|
return mh.invoke(); |
|
} |
|
catch (RuntimeException | Error e) { |
|
throw e; |
|
} |
|
catch (Throwable e) { |
|
throw new LinkageError("Unexpected throwable", e); |
|
} |
|
} |
|
/** |
|
* Returns the value of a static final field declared in the class which |
|
* is the same as the field's type (or, for primitive-valued fields, |
|
* declared in the wrapper class.) This is a simplified form of |
|
* {@link #getStaticFinal(MethodHandles.Lookup, String, Class, Class)} |
|
* for the case where a class declares distinguished constant instances of |
|
* itself. |
|
* |
|
* @param lookup the lookup context describing the class performing the |
|
* operation (normally stacked by the JVM) |
|
* @param name the name of the field |
|
* @param type the type of the field |
|
* @return the value of the field |
|
* @throws IllegalAccessError if the declaring class or the field is not |
|
* accessible to the class performing the operation |
|
* @throws NoSuchFieldError if the specified field does not exist |
|
* @throws IncompatibleClassChangeError if the specified field is not |
|
* {@code final} |
|
* @see #getStaticFinal(MethodHandles.Lookup, String, Class, Class) |
|
*/ |
|
public static Object getStaticFinal(MethodHandles.Lookup lookup, String name, Class<?> type) { |
|
requireNonNull(type); |
|
Class<?> declaring = type.isPrimitive() |
|
? Wrapper.forPrimitiveType(type).wrapperType() |
|
: type; |
|
return getStaticFinal(lookup, name, type, declaring); |
|
} |
|
/** |
|
* Returns the result of invoking a method handle with the provided |
|
* arguments. |
|
* <p> |
|
* This method behaves as if the method handle to be invoked is the result |
|
* of adapting the given method handle, via {@link MethodHandle#asType}, to |
|
* adjust the return type to the desired type. |
|
* |
|
* @param lookup unused |
|
* @param name unused |
|
* @param type the desired type of the value to be returned, which must be |
|
* compatible with the return type of the method handle |
|
* @param handle the method handle to be invoked |
|
* @param args the arguments to pass to the method handle, as if with |
|
* {@link MethodHandle#invokeWithArguments}. Each argument may be |
|
* {@code null}. |
|
* @return the result of invoking the method handle |
|
* @throws WrongMethodTypeException if the handle's method type cannot be |
|
* adjusted to take the given number of arguments, or if the handle's return |
|
* type cannot be adjusted to the desired type |
|
* @throws ClassCastException if an argument or the result produced by |
|
* invoking the handle cannot be converted by reference casting |
|
* @throws Throwable anything thrown by the method handle invocation |
|
*/ |
|
public static Object invoke(MethodHandles.Lookup lookup, String name, Class<?> type, |
|
MethodHandle handle, Object... args) throws Throwable { |
|
requireNonNull(type); |
|
requireNonNull(handle); |
|
requireNonNull(args); |
|
if (type != handle.type().returnType()) { |
|
// Adjust the return type of the handle to be invoked while |
|
// preserving variable arity if present |
|
handle = handle.asType(handle.type().changeReturnType(type)). |
|
withVarargs(handle.isVarargsCollector()); |
|
} |
|
return handle.invokeWithArguments(args); |
|
} |
|
/** |
|
* Finds a {@link VarHandle} for an instance field. |
|
* |
|
* @param lookup the lookup context describing the class performing the |
|
* operation (normally stacked by the JVM) |
|
* @param name the name of the field |
|
* @param type the required result type (must be {@code Class<VarHandle>}) |
|
* @param declaringClass the class in which the field is declared |
|
* @param fieldType the type of the field |
|
* @return the {@link VarHandle} |
|
* @throws IllegalAccessError if the declaring class or the field is not |
|
* accessible to the class performing the operation |
|
* @throws NoSuchFieldError if the specified field does not exist |
|
* @throws IllegalArgumentException if the type is not {@code VarHandle} |
|
*/ |
|
public static VarHandle fieldVarHandle(MethodHandles.Lookup lookup, String name, Class<VarHandle> type, |
|
Class<?> declaringClass, Class<?> fieldType) { |
|
requireNonNull(lookup); |
|
requireNonNull(name); |
|
requireNonNull(type); |
|
requireNonNull(declaringClass); |
|
requireNonNull(fieldType); |
|
if (type != VarHandle.class) { |
|
throw new IllegalArgumentException(); |
|
} |
|
try { |
|
return lookup.findVarHandle(declaringClass, name, fieldType); |
|
} |
|
catch (ReflectiveOperationException e) { |
|
throw mapLookupExceptionToError(e); |
|
} |
|
} |
|
/** |
|
* Finds a {@link VarHandle} for a static field. |
|
* |
|
* @param lookup the lookup context describing the class performing the |
|
* operation (normally stacked by the JVM) |
|
* @param name the name of the field |
|
* @param type the required result type (must be {@code Class<VarHandle>}) |
|
* @param declaringClass the class in which the field is declared |
|
* @param fieldType the type of the field |
|
* @return the {@link VarHandle} |
|
* @throws IllegalAccessError if the declaring class or the field is not |
|
* accessible to the class performing the operation |
|
* @throws NoSuchFieldError if the specified field does not exist |
|
* @throws IllegalArgumentException if the type is not {@code VarHandle} |
|
*/ |
|
public static VarHandle staticFieldVarHandle(MethodHandles.Lookup lookup, String name, Class<VarHandle> type, |
|
Class<?> declaringClass, Class<?> fieldType) { |
|
requireNonNull(lookup); |
|
requireNonNull(name); |
|
requireNonNull(type); |
|
requireNonNull(declaringClass); |
|
requireNonNull(fieldType); |
|
if (type != VarHandle.class) { |
|
throw new IllegalArgumentException(); |
|
} |
|
try { |
|
return lookup.findStaticVarHandle(declaringClass, name, fieldType); |
|
} |
|
catch (ReflectiveOperationException e) { |
|
throw mapLookupExceptionToError(e); |
|
} |
|
} |
|
/** |
|
* Finds a {@link VarHandle} for an array type. |
|
* |
|
* @param lookup the lookup context describing the class performing the |
|
* operation (normally stacked by the JVM) |
|
* @param name unused |
|
* @param type the required result type (must be {@code Class<VarHandle>}) |
|
* @param arrayClass the type of the array |
|
* @return the {@link VarHandle} |
|
* @throws IllegalAccessError if the component type of the array is not |
|
* accessible to the class performing the operation |
|
* @throws IllegalArgumentException if the type is not {@code VarHandle} |
|
*/ |
|
public static VarHandle arrayVarHandle(MethodHandles.Lookup lookup, String name, Class<VarHandle> type, |
|
Class<?> arrayClass) { |
|
requireNonNull(lookup); |
|
requireNonNull(type); |
|
requireNonNull(arrayClass); |
|
if (type != VarHandle.class) { |
|
throw new IllegalArgumentException(); |
|
} |
|
return MethodHandles.arrayElementVarHandle(validateClassAccess(lookup, arrayClass)); |
|
} |
|
private static <T> Class<T> validateClassAccess(MethodHandles.Lookup lookup, Class<T> type) { |
|
try { |
|
lookup.accessClass(type); |
|
return type; |
|
} |
|
catch (ReflectiveOperationException ex) { |
|
throw mapLookupExceptionToError(ex); |
|
} |
|
} |
|
} |
